    Default Span QItemDelegate over multiple rows in view

    Hello

    I want to make an agenda widget (like Google Agenda). I'm trying to make it with model/view architecture.

    When, for example, every row represents 30 minutes and you have an appointment of two hours, how can you make an item delegate that spans the four rows?

    I've checked QxtScheduleView, etc. but I don't really understand how they manage to make it work .

    Should I use QGraphicsScene, etc. instead?
